Bernstein analysts have issued a note declaring “this is the moment” to invest in American Tower Corporation (AMT), signaling confidence in the communication infrastructure REIT. The call points to a potentially attractive entry point as the company navigates shifts in 5G deployment and interest rate expectations.

In a recent research note, Bernstein highlighted American Tower as a standout opportunity in the real estate investment trust (REIT) space, urging investors to consider the stock now. The firm’s analysts cited the company’s extensive global portfolio of wireless towers and data centers, which could benefit from continued network densification and the rollout of 5G services. Bernstein’s commentary also noted that recent market volatility may have created a more favorable valuation for AMT relative to its long-term earnings power. The note did not specify a price target but emphasized the potential for capital appreciation and dividend growth. The bullish stance comes amid broader sector debates over tower REITs, which have faced headwinds from rising interest rates and carrier consolidation. Bernstein’s perspective suggests that current headwinds could be temporary and that American Tower’s scale and contractual lease structures provide resilience.

Key takeaways from the Bernstein call include a focus on American Tower’s fundamental strengths: a diverse tenant base, long-term inflation-adjusted leases, and a strong presence in both developed and emerging markets. The firm likely sees the recent pullback in the stock as an overreaction to near-term macro concerns, such as higher borrowing costs and slower telecom spending. Bernstein’s timing (“this is the moment”) implies a belief that the risk-reward balance has shifted favorably. For investors, the note reinforces the idea that tower REITs could regain momentum as 5G investment cycles accelerate and data consumption grows. However, the sector remains sensitive to interest rate movements, which may affect valuation multiples. The call may also reflect expectations that American Tower’s international operations could drive incremental growth, especially in markets with lower penetration and rising smartphone adoption.

The note may encourage investors to evaluate the company’s long-term cash flow potential against current pricing. While the call does not guarantee outperformance, it highlights the possibility that AMT is undervalued relative to its growth trajectory. Investors should weigh the risks: potential regulatory changes, higher-than-expected interest rates, and shifts in telecom infrastructure spending could affect returns. Additionally, competition from small cells and fiber-based solutions may pose long-term challenges. Nonetheless, the endorsement from a major sell-side firm may provide a catalyst for increased investor attention. As with any single analyst call, prudent investors are advised to conduct their own due diligence and consider portfolio diversification.
